Warehouse bin types refer to the different categories or classifications of storage locations within a warehouse this could be a pallet, floor space, BIC etc. These types are used to optimize space, improve organization, and make the retrieval and storage of inventory more efficient. Warehouse bin types can be defined by a variety of factors, including size, accessibility, function, or the type of inventory being stored.
To see the warehouse bin types page, on WMS web app, go to Warehouse > Configuration and Setup > Warehouse - Bin Types.
Create Bin Type
1. To add/create a bin, on warehouse bin types page, click on Create Bin Type, a pop-up to create a new warehouse bin type will display, as shown below.
2. Manually enter the bin type and then click on Create to add bin. Once bin is added it will display on the warehouse bin types list as shown below.
3. Double click on the newly bin type, the detail of bin will display on the right side of the page as shown below.
To add/edit the Bin Type
1. If you wish to add/edit the bin type, on bin detail section, fill the details as describe below:
a. Bin Title: This field helps to update the bin title.
b. Max. Weight: This field allows you to manually enter the bin maximum capacity of load.
c. Max. Volume: This field allows you to manually enter the bin maximum volume of load.
d. BMax Qty: This field allows you to manually enter the bin maximum quantity of load.
e. Bin Type Length: This field allows you to manually enter the bin length.
f. Bin Type Width: This field allows you to manually enter the bin width.
g. Bin Type Height: This field allows you to manually enter the bin height.
i. Active: Use the toggle button to enable or disable the rule.
2. Once changes have been made, click on Update button to save the changes.
3. If you wish to filter the bin type page, on bin type list use inline filters and manually enter the bin title, Bin max. Weight, Length etc. in the respective field.
